Living Room Dining Table
A living room dining table refers to a dining table placed within or adjacent to a living space, typically used in open-plan layouts where dining and lounging areas are combined. It serves as a multifunctional surface for meals, entertaining, working, and everyday living, making it a key piece in modern home design.
In contemporary interiors, living room dining tables are carefully chosen to balance practicality with style, helping define zones within open spaces while maintaining visual harmony.

Why Living Room Dining Tables Are Popular
The appeal of a living room dining table lies in its versatility. As open-plan living becomes more common, homeowners increasingly need furniture that works across multiple functions without compromising style.
These tables help create structure within larger spaces, visually separating dining and living zones while maintaining an open, connected feel. They are especially useful in apartments, loft-style homes, and modern family living spaces.

Popular Styles of Living Room Dining Tables
Living room dining tables come in a variety of designs:
Round Dining Tables
- Encourage conversation and social interaction
- Ideal for smaller or open-plan spaces
- Soften angular room layouts
Rectangular Dining Tables
- Traditional and space-efficient
- Suitable for larger households
- Fit neatly into defined dining zones
Extendable Dining Tables
- Flexible for everyday use and entertaining
- Expand when needed for guests
- Practical for multifunctional living rooms
Glass Dining Tables
- Create a light, airy feel
- Ideal for modern and minimalist interiors
- Help visually open up smaller spaces
Wooden Dining Tables
- Add warmth and natural texture
- Suitable for rustic, modern, or classic interiors
- Highly durable and long-lasting

How to Use a Dining Table in a Living Room
In open-plan layouts, the dining table is often used as a central dividing element between living and kitchen areas. Its placement helps define zones without the need for walls or partitions.
It can also serve multiple purposes beyond dining, including working from home, social gatherings, or creative activities. Choosing the right size and shape ensures the space remains functional and visually balanced.
Styling Tips
Use a rug beneath the dining table to define the dining zone within a larger living room.
Choose seating that complements both dining and living furniture for a cohesive look.
Add pendant lighting above the table to create a focal point and enhance ambience.
